Edit: Keeping Alucard EQ is a sit sounds, you get to keep it via skipping the cutscene by force where you lose it all. Normally, you'd walk in, Death talks to you, then steals your EQ. If you play on super Luck mode (all stats 0 except Luck is 99, and HP is 25), you need to gain one level and make sure you have enough DEF to take a hit, and live. Have a Warg bite you in the room before hand, sending Alucard flying very very VERY fast across the screens, shooting past the cutscene.
Succubus Glitch is... weird. Basically, you have the Succubus Soul (Bullet type, so ^ + Attack = special move) and you have a dagger that can pull off the backstab special attack. You activate the SS, which is a small animation of Soma lunging forward maybe have a character sprite, and biting whatever's in front of him. He gets a special red aura around him, making him invincible for a set period of time. When he's in mid lunge, you use the dagger's SA, which prolong's the effect. OK, so you stab 2 or three times to prolong the effect (it wears off quickly), then do the SA again, and viola, when the red aura disappears, all actions you are doing stop. So, you did the teleporting backstab, right? Bam, you can travel through normally impassable walls and stuff. Now for teh glitch to REALLY get weird. When you do the backstab attack, you can lodge yourself in a wall, sending Soma flying forever and ever upwards for a long time. When/if he stops, you move left or right or something, and then you appear in a random room (hopefully. Otherwise, you just wasted 15-20 minutes), and you have suddenly collected skills and abilities and weapons and items you should never ave at this point (Or ever! You can get skills that belong to the other character modes this way, including Alucard's bat transformation that doesn't go away with a NG+!)
